Analysis Archive Storage Configuration
For information on what the analysis archive is and how it works, see Concepts: Analysis Archive
The Analysis Archive is an object store with specific semantics and thus is configured as an object store using the same configuration options as object_store
which is used for the active working set of images, just with a different config key: analysis_archive
Amazon S3 Example
Example configuration snippet for using the DB for working set object store and Amazon S3 for the analysis archive:
...
services:
...
catalog:
...
object_store:
compression:
enabled: false
min_size_kbytes: 100
storage_driver:
name: db
config: {}
analysis_archive:
compression:
enabled: False
min_size_kbytes: 100
storage_driver:
name: 's3'
config:
iamauto: True
region: <AWS_REGION_HERE>
bucket: 'anchorearchive'
create_bucket: True
S3-Compatible Example
Example configuration snippet for using the DB for working set object store and S3-API compatible object storage for the analysis archive:
...
services:
...
catalog:
...
object_store:
compression:
enabled: false
min_size_kbytes: 100
storage_driver:
name: db
config: {}
analysis_archive:
compression:
enabled: False
min_size_kbytes: 100
storage_driver:
name: 's3'
config:
access_key: 'MY_ACCESS_KEY'
secret_key: 'MY_SECRET_KEY'
url: 'https://my-s3-compatible-endpoint.example.com:optional_port'
region: False
bucket: 'anchorearchive'
create_bucket: True
Default Configuration
By default, if no analysis_archive
config is found or the property is not present in the config.yaml, the analysis archive
will use the object_store
or archive
(for backwards compatibility) config sections and those defaults (e.g. db if found).
Anchore stores all of the analysis archive objects in an internal logical bucket: analysis_archive that is distinct in the configured backends (e.g a key prefix in the s3 bucket)
Changing Configuration
Unless there are image analyses actually in the archive, there is no data to move if you need to update the configuration
to use a different backend, but once an image analysis has been archived to update the configuration you must follow
the object storage data migration process found here. As noted in that guide, if you need
to migrate to/from an analysis_archive
config you’ll need to use the –from-analysis-archive/–to-analysis-archive
options as needed to tell the migration process which configuration to use in the source and destination config files
used for the migration.
